So this week went by really fast, the work is mais ou menos going well... this week what has been the theme I think is the craziness in the communication... It all started with this one family that didnt understand a single word we said, not a single word... (they might have been joking with us)... we got there, asked questions like ´´how many kids are in the family´´ and they just stared at us and told us to stop talking english.. It was kinda funny. We were talking at snail speed and super loud hoping they would understand and it didnt help, so we just had the daughter read the Restoration pamphlet and then when she was done we gave them thumbs up and tried inviting them to church and just got out of there.

So then we taught a family and at the end of the restoration we asked what they thought and how they felt, and the son said ´´I feel like this is the true church´´, and we were all HALLELUJAH, and we invited him to be baptised, and he said he already was (we assumed in another church cause we get this answer all day) but we explained he needed to be baptised again but by the priesthood etc. and by the end he accepted a date. The next day we went back and found out he really was baptised and was inactive, they showed us pictures of the elders that taught them years ago haha, the Dad who also said he would be baptised and was married turns out wasnt married ´´on paper´´ so that one fell too..
Then yesterday we taught a lady that loves the church, loves the missionaries, shes old and lives alone and is almost deaf, so nobody talks with her anymore she said. Nossa, she is the sweetest lady, her voice is like the top key on the piano and is so cute, and has a FAT dog. So after all these experiences I find myself doubting my portuguese and feel like everybody the past 5 months have just been pretending to understand what I say....
